Output 46fabfa5117053065bbd642bb27bd83933c62519acd4c1c3c5dbd87acc4bb7d6:0

value
2130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8030583ab96df33ab87456f25a29aed3e72e9258 OP_EQUAL
address
3DNpL9F7jc97LFypekWh7MFJAMDDTt3kqz
transaction
46fabfa5117053065bbd642bb27bd83933c62519acd4c1c3c5dbd87acc4bb7d6
spent
true